Установка сервера лицензий Tekla: установка вручную

Tekla Structures
2022
Tekla Structures

Установка сервера лицензий Tekla: установка вручную

Использовать установку вручную имеет смысл в случае, если вы хотите отдельно установить сервер лицензий, отредактировать файл лицензий, настроить сервер лицензий и запустить программное обеспечение сервера лицензий. При установке сервера лицензий Tekla вручную устанавливается также два файла: installanchorservice.exe и uninstallanchorservice.exe. Эти файлы необходимы при установке и удалении службы лицензирования FlexNet вручную.

Устанавливать сервер лицензий вручную имеет смысл, например, если предусмотренный по умолчанию порт TCP/IP 27007 уже используется другими службами или приложениями, и необходимо указать в файле лицензий tekla.lic другой порт.

Прежде чем приступать к установке сервера лицензий, остановите другие службы лицензирования FlexNet.

Чтобы установить сервер лицензий вручную:

  1. Чтобы загрузить установочный пакет сервера лицензий с последними обновлениями, перейдите на сервис Tekla Downloads, выберите версию Tekla Structures и нажмите кнопку Все загрузки. На следующей странице выберите License server в списке File type и нажмите Apply filter. Затем выберите License server.
  2. Выберите язык установки.
  3. Выберите Вручную в качестве типа установки сервера лицензий и выполните установку.
  4. Перейдите в меню Пуск или на начальный экран (в зависимости от операционной системы Windows) и откройте командную строку с правами администратора.
  5. В командной строке введите следующие команды:
    1. cd /d %SYSTEMDRIVE%\Tekla\License\Server
    2. installanchorservice.exe

      Сервер лицензий установлен.

  6. Отредактируйте файл лицензий, чтобы включить в него имя хоста или IP-адрес сервера и правильный порт TCP/IP:
    1. Откройте папку ..\Tekla\License\Server на серверном компьютере.
    2. Откройте файл tekla.lic (файл лицензий) в текстовом редакторе.
    3. Замените текст localhost в строке SERVER localhost ANY именем хоста (компьютера) или IP-адресом сервера лицензий.
    4. Введите номер порта TCP/IP после текста SERVER server_hostname ANY.
    5. Сохраните изменения и закройте текстовый редактор.
  7. Выберите Tekla Licensing > LMTOOLS в меню Пуск или на начальном экране, в зависимости от используемой версии Windows.
  8. На вкладке Service/License File выберите Configuration using Services.
  9. На вкладке Config Services выполните следующие действия, чтобы настроить службу лицензирования:
    1. В поле Service Name введите имя службы (в точности так, как показано): Tekla Licensing Service.
    2. Нажимайте кнопки Browse и найдите файлы lmgrd.exe (диспетчер сервера лицензий), tekla.lic и tekla_debug.log.

      По умолчанию lmgrd.exe файлы tekla.lic и tekla_debug.log находятся в папке C:\Tekla\License\Server.

      Обратите внимание, что если указать в поле Path to the debug log file расположение за пределами папки "C:\ProgramData\...", появится сообщение об ошибке: «Windows preferred path <системный диск>\ProgramData to store service data is not set». На это сообщение можно не обращать внимание.

    3. Установите флажок Use Services, чтобы запустить службу лицензирования как службу Windows.
    4. Установите флажок Start Server at Power Up, чтобы служба лицензирования запускалась автоматически при запуске Windows.
    5. Нажмите кнопку Save Service, чтобы сохранить настройки.

  10. Перейдите на вкладку Start/Stop/Reread и нажмите кнопку Start Server, чтобы запустить сервер лицензий.

  11. Перейдите на вкладку Server Status и нажмите кнопку Perform Status Enquiry.

    В списке состояний в строке License server status отображаются порт TCP/IP и имя компьютера, на котором установлен сервер лицензий.

    Теперь можно активировать лицензии и подключать Tekla Structures к серверу лицензий.

    Также можно сменить язык пользовательского интерфейса в Tekla License Administration Tool, открыв программу и нажав кнопку Language.

Была ли эта информация полезной?
Назад
Далее